Guilty but Forgiven

Sometimes I think it's hard for a Christian to forget the feelings of guilt. After all, we are all still sinners. In fact, I think we tend to anguish in it. Instead we should "rest" in God. Today I was reminded of this beautiful quote from Kierkegaard in his Journals. It goes like this:

"A man rests in the forgiveness of sins when the thought of God does not remind him of the sin but that it is forgiven, when the past is not a memory of how much he trespassed but of how much he has been forgiven."
